Matson Construction is a building, remodeling and custom millwork company serving the Washington DC Metro area and Northern VA with all types of services in the commercial and residential sectors of construction.
             Our home office is located in Fairfax, Virginia, giving us a centralized location and base of operation in our area of the market. The operating staff of Matson Construction is very familiar with the building practices of the mid-atlantic region and has experience ranging from high end historical renovations to LEED/ Green New construction. We strive to keep our design and building practices current with the ever changing codes and specifications of the construction industry.
            Our customer base consists of individual home owners looking for top notch home maintenance, home flippers looking to maximize their profits with reasonably priced, fast, high quality renovations, and other builders and contractors looking to subcontract work to meet criteria in contracts that they could not achieve on their own. Matson Construction can meet the needs of any residential or commercial construction project, big or small.
